Context

The ‘Dead Cat Bounce’ pattern is a technical analysis term for a temporary recovery of asset prices from a prolonged decline, followed by the continuation of the downtrend. While it suggests a potential continuation of the bearish trend, it also highlights short-term buying interest. This market’s current movement could be an example of such a pattern.
